Understanding the Challenge: Mental Health Misdiagnosis Rates
Mental health misdiagnosis rates remain a significant challenge within the healthcare system, particularly at facilities like Lone Tree Kaiser Permanente mental health services, as discussed on Reddit communities dedicated to shared experiences. This issue is multifaceted, involving complex symptoms that often overlap, making accurate identification difficult. For instance, what starts as manageable anxiety can evolve into depression, or an underlying trauma may manifest as chronic stress, each requiring distinct treatment approaches. According to various studies, misdiagnosis rates in mental health are alarmingly high, with some conditions being consistently overlooked. This is a critical concern, as incorrect diagnoses can lead to inappropriate treatments, delayed proper care, and even exacerbation of symptoms, impacting individuals’ overall well-being and quality of life.

Strategies for Improving Diagnosis Consistency and Patient Care
To enhance mental illness diagnosis accuracy and patient care, healthcare providers at Lone Tree Kaiser Permanente mental health services on Reddit have implemented several strategies. One key approach is to promote continuous training and education for staff, keeping them updated with the latest research and treatment methods. This includes workshops focused on recognizing subtle symptoms, understanding comorbidities, and learning evidence-based practices. By fostering a culture of knowledge-sharing, healthcare professionals can improve consistency in diagnosis across different practitioners.
Additionally, integrating tools for comprehensive patient assessment has been beneficial. This involves using structured interviews and standardized questionnaires to gather detailed information about patients’ experiences and symptoms. Incorporating self-report measures alongside clinical evaluations aids in catching nuances that might be overlooked during traditional face-to-face interactions.
